Evening new to all this but NEED HELP. I bought a 1998 Four Winn Horizon and low and below the previous owner didn't winterize it correct and cracked the block. Now I need help trying to find a block and was wondering if anyone could help point me in the right direction? My mode is 302CPBYC and can't seem to find one. I was wondering if a 1988 302AMRGDP block would work as a replacement block or if its too old? Please help point me in the right direction or tell me what other block are interchangeable? Ayuh,.... Welcome Aboard,... Any boat with a 3.0l, Newer than 1990 will have the same long block motor as yer's,.....

A Pre-'90, long block motor, will need it's older flywheel, 'n coupler to mount into yer boat,....

OMC, Merc, or Volvo are the same Long Block, with different accessories bolted to 'em,.....

Ayuh,.... You can use either a 2.5l, or 3.0l boat motor Long Block,.....

Ya need to use the OMC dressin's on it though,....

If ya can't find a 3.0l long block, ya ain't lookin' hard enough,....

You can't use a Merc motor, unless ya strip it to a Long Block, 'n put the OMC accessories on it,.....

Goin' to a V6 or V8 means yer drive will be incompatible,....
You'd need a drive for a V6 or V8,...
